March 2025 celestial events: Mercury, Venus, Mars, Jupiter, and lunar eclipse
March is a fantastic month for skywatchers, offering the chance to see Venus, Jupiter, and Mercury, as well as witness a spectacular lunar eclipse. So, when will the lunar eclipse take place? Where will it be visible? Here are the details...
The lunar eclipse in question will turn our satellite a reddish color. At the same time, due to the decrease in moonlight, there will be a clear sky for space observers. Therefore, it will be possible to discover some deep-sky treasures.
Astronomers say that observing from a wide and open area, such as a lakeshore or the seaside, will be beneficial.

VISIBILITY OF THE MOON AND PLANETS IN MARCH:
Mercury: Visible for only a few weeks every 3 to 4 months, Mercury will be visible just below Venus during the first 10 days of March. It can be seen low in the western sky about 30 minutes after sunset. Although spotting Mercury is not always easy, catching this agile planet is a valuable prize for every skywatcher. Best date for observation: March 7-9

Venus: Remaining low in the west after sunset in the first weeks of the month, Venus will gradually sink lower day by day. By mid-March, it will become difficult to see in the sky.

Mars: You can find Mars high in the eastern sky after sunset. It remains visible until around 3 AM.

Jupiter: Observable high in the western sky after dark, Jupiter disappears from view around 1 AM every night.

Moon: There is always a solar eclipse a few weeks before or after a total lunar eclipse. The eclipse of the Moon, which will turn into a crimson sphere within a few hours between March 13 and March 14, will unfortunately not be clearly visible from Turkey.
